Senior BJP leader and Union Home Minister Amit Shah alleged that RJD and Congress are anti-backward class and opponent of extremely backward classes. Addressing a public meeting in Paliganj in Patna on Saturday, Mr. Shah claimed that only BJP can work for welfare of backward and poor classes. He said Prime Minister Narendra Modi has proved it by implementing various types of welfare schemes. Mr. Shah said both Congress and RJD are dynastic parties and will never work in favour of poor and backward classes. The BJP leader said in Congress Sonia Gandhi wants to make Rahul Gandhi Prime minister and Lalu Prasad wants that his son becomes Chief Minister. He also said by honouring Jananayak Karpoori Thakur with Bharat Ratna, the BJP has fulfilled long time pending demand of people of Bihar. Mr Shah said Congress and RJD is only doing politics on the name of backward but did not take care of them.
